WFF goes West! FLOATING CAROUSEL Screening + Filmmaker Q&A

  • Living Room Theaters 341 Southwest 10th Avenue Portland, OR, 97205 United States (map)
 
 

This special screening at Living Room Theaters in Portland, OR features the award-winning FLOATING CAROUSEL which world premiered at the 2025 Woodstock Film Festival, preceded by the short film PORELESS. Following the screening, the Co-Directors/Co-Writers of FLOATING CAROUSEL, Delilah Napier and Lucy Powers, will join for a Q&A. Reception and meet and greet in the Living Room Theaters bar/lobby to follow. 

The event is designed to connect with filmmakers and cinephiles, and strengthen our network of creators in the Portland, OR area. This retrospective reflects Living Room Theaters’ ongoing initiative to expand impactful post-film discussions and bring meaningful filmmaker engagement to the local community. Meira Blaustein, Co-Founder and Executive Director of WFF, will also be in attendance. 

FLOATING CAROUSEL is a dark comedy about dating in modern day New York City that takes an apocalyptic turn - a look at love, or attempts to find it, in a time that has been called the loneliest century.

About the Short Film, PORELESS: A fabulous, queer Muslim beauty entrepreneur must figure out how to compete in a Shark Tank-like product pitch contest after suffering an untimely allergic reaction.

About Living Room Theaters:

Living Room Theaters is independently owned and operated with a specific focus on independent films and the local community. Founded by filmmakers passionate about elevating the cinema experience, LRT has re-imagined every aspect of the movie-going process, from programming and exhibition to the lobby experience and prepared restaurant food and beverage offerings. LRT truly loves movies and strives to provide an exceptional theater experience that is both intimate and accommodating. Their commitment to great customer service, high-quality entertainment, and reasonable pricing ensures that every visit is a memorable one. They also prioritize a seamless viewing experience without lengthy ad reels or countless trailers before the film. All movies are digitally projected in 2K and 4K resolution with 5.1 / 7.1 surround sound.
